Intel Xeon Phi x200, codename Knights Landing (KNL), is second generation MIC architecture product from Intel. At HPC2N 36 nodes, as a part of Kebnekaise, are equipped with Intel Xeon Phi 7250 CPUs. See our description of Intel Knight Landing for more information about the nodes.

Kebnekaise is the latest supercomputer at HPC2N. It is named after the massif of the same name, which has some of Sweden's highest mountain peaks (Sydtoppen and Nordtoppen). Just as the massif, the supercomputer Kebnekaise is a system with many faces.
